I was trying to install 4.0 Server on my dual P133 with a 1 Gig SCSI harddrive. The controller card is BT-946C and I have my 4X SCSI CD-ROM at ID 4 and the harddrive at ID 5. I formated the harddrive using FAT16 and when installing using the /B option, it gives me an error message saying that "Windows NT disable direct access to hardware...for more info, check LOCK /?" something like that. I heard of this command but was never able to find it. Has anyone encountered this problem before? I also tried installing using the floppies but it says NTKONALLMP. something can't be copied hence quiting the installation process. Anyone please help? When you are in DOS mode... before typing winnt /b, type "lock" and Enter.
on the question, anwser (Y) and Enter.
You will be able to write on your HD
